OSX and SDL using OpenGL got endianess ARGH!

I am having a problem with SDL and OpenGL. I would like to use SDL to
load a .bmp or .png file as a texture and send that info to gltexture().
I don’t know if this is possible or not? SDL uses SDL_Surface as a
return type for the LoadBMP(). I don’t know how I could use that when I
need a unsigned char I think for a type in gltextures()? If anyone has
some code or a good site with this info on it I would love to see it! I
tried coding a () to load .bmps but ran into endianess and argh I don’t
know enough to deal with that either. Thanks in Advance.

Hi

Take a look in testgl.c in the tests folder - the procedure is fully
explained in there.

You might want to make sure you have the very latest testgl.c as this is a
fairly recent addition. Get it from the CVS if you are unsure.
